Rohit Sharma was the point of discussion in Indian cricket after he was picked in the playing XI for the first Test against South Africa as an opener. While many felt it was a wrong move, some of the pundits also supported his elevation. And Rohit reposed the faith they showed in him by driving, cutting and flicking his way to his maiden hundred as an opener on Wednesday, 2 October, to silence those who had questioned his technique against the red cherry.

Meanwhile, Twitterati also lauded Rohit's effort, who was batting on 115 when bad light stopped play on the first day in Visakhapatnam.

Former India spinner Harbhajan Singh tweeted: "Wah @ImRo45 Brilliant 100.. dress blue ho ya white koi fark nahi padta.. Rohit HiT hai bhai (Brilliant ton by Rohit, it doesn't matter whether he is in the ODI or Test team. He is a hit)."

Posting a picture of the opener, leg-spinner Yuzvendra Chahal wrote: "Real G.O.A.T".

ICC also acknowledged Rohit's superb knock and said: "The HITMAN is back with a bang. Rohit Sharma gets his first Test ton as an opener!"

Indian cricketer and Rohit’s Mumbai Indians teammate Suryakumar Yadav wrote, “The format of the game just doesn't matter. Scoring centuries has become like a habit for you Rohit”.

Former India opener and commentator Aakash Chopra also praised Rohit and tweeted: "4th Test Century. 1st as an opener. Rohit has grabbed the opportunity with both hands. Well played."
